Abstract
A natural language processing system that includes an artificial intelligence (AI) engine, a tagging engine, and a resource allocation engine. The AI engine is configured to receive a set of audio files and to identify concepts within the set of audio files. The AI engine is further configured to determine a usage frequency for each of the identified concepts and to generate an AI-defined tag for concepts with a usage frequency that is greater than a usage frequency threshold. The tagging engine is configured to receive an audio file and to modify metadata for the audio file to include AI-defined tags. The resource allocation engine is configured to identify a storage location from among the plurality of storage devices based on tags associated with the audio file and send the audio file to the identified storage location.
